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

microk

lightbox dinamica em asp e sql

Recommended Posts

Boa noite

Gente estou com um pequeno problema para desenvolver lightbox dinâmica em asp e SQL, e que posso fazer o upload das fotos para o banco de dados. Após fazer o Upload das fotos, exista possibilidade do ASP fazer a leitura da pasta onde as fotos estão após fazer a leitura das fotos gera a página onde as fotos vão ser mostradas

 

Obrigado pela atenção.

 

 

Microk Soluções inteligentes

Compartilhar este post


Link para o post
Compartilhar em outros sites

Calma ae, você colocou assim

 

Autometicamente fazer um filtro para selecionar da galeria cadastrada

Ou seja fazer um filtro para selecionar da galeria cadastrada? não entendi, reformule novamente a sua dúvida por favor.

 

Coloquei um exemplo simples de uma galeria usando o lightbox veja se ela te ajuda, coloquei no rapidshare

 

http://rapidshare.com/files/250108951/img.zip.html

Compartilhar este post


Link para o post
Compartilhar em outros sites

dinamicamente fica melhor usando AJAX, mas desculpe naun entendi muito bem...

especifique mais..., mas olha este exemplo:

 

em um bd com essa estrutura,tabela com o nome de TB_FOTOS com os seguintes campos:

id_foto

foto

 

default.asp


<%
' Descrevendo caminho do seu banco de dados
strCon = "DBQ=c:inetpubwwwrootimgbdBD.mdb;Driver={Microsoft Access Driver (*.mdb)};"

' Abrindo conexão e record set para chamar informações da Tabela com o nome das fotos.
Set objRS = Server.CreateObject("ADODB.Recordset")
objRS.CursorLocation = 3
objRS.CursorType = 0
objRS.LockType = 1
strSQL = "SELECT * FROM TB_FOTOS"
objRS.Open strSQL, strCon
%>
<html>
<head>
<title>Mostrando Imagens</title>
<%
'Chamando arquivos para CSS e javascript para utilização do script.
%>
<link rel="stylesheet" href="css/lightbox.css" type="text/css" media="screen" /> 
<script src="js/prototype.js" type="text/javascript"></script>
<script src="js/scriptaculous.js?load=effects" type="text/javascript"></script>
<script src="js/lightbox.js" type="text/javascript"></script>
<style type="text/css">
.texto {
font-family: Verdana;
font-size: 10px;
color: #000000;
}
</style>
</head>
<body scroll="auto">
<table width="265" border="0" cellpadding="15" cellspacing="1" bgcolor="#D4D0C8">
  <tr>
	<td bgcolor="#F7F5F4"><span class="texto"><strong>Galeria de Imagens</strong></span></td>
  </tr>
  <tr>
	<td bgcolor="#FDFDFD"><table width="0" border="0" cellpadding="5" cellspacing="1" bgcolor="#FAF9F8">
	  <tr></tr>
	  <tr>
<% 
'Iniciando variável contador e loop para exibir em colunas
i = 1 
Do While Not objRS.EOF 
%>
		<td bgcolor="#D4D0C8" class="texto"><a href="fotos/<%=objRS("foto")%>" rel="lightbox[roadtrip]"><img src="fotos/<%=objRS("foto")%>" border="0" width="100"height="80"></a></td>
		<%
'Define quantidade de colunas
If i = 2 Then 
i = 0 
Response.Write "</TR><TR>" 
End If 
i = i + 1 
objRS.MoveNext 
Loop 
%>
	  </tr>
	  <tr></tr>
	</table></td>
  </tr>
 </table>
</body>
</html>
<%
objRS.close
%>

Compartilhar este post


Link para o post
Compartilhar em outros sites

Muito bom seu código.

 

Queria primeiramente saber como seria a galeria feita e AJAX.

 

acorrem periodicamente. E que esse sistema tivesse uma página de UPLOAD onde o ADM posso pegas as fotos da sua máquina e jogar no servidor (Nesse processo seria pedido nome da pasta e nome do evento). Após pegar as fotos do PC, existiria uma página para fazer a leitura do diretório onde as fotos estarão após a leitura era a vez de entrar a outra página ASP que teria o papel de gera a lightbox na página predefinida para receber a miniatura e o nome do evento. Quando o usuário clicar abre a página gerada para receber a galeria.

 

 

Valeu!!!!!

Compartilhar este post


Link para o post
Compartilhar em outros sites

dá uma pesquisada no forum k existem exemplos...

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.